Property Description
See the best of the past and present in this stunning, one of a kind, FULLY RESTORED 1880 Queen Anne Victorian! Solid and stately, it has been renovated with modern amenities while retaining its original details and character. The exterior charms together with intricate woodwork, a grand WRAP-AROUND PORCH with ornate columns, and colorful stained-glass windows. As you cross the threshold, the foyer greets you with a modern chandelier casting a warm glow over the ORIGINAL WOOD FLOORING and a majestic staircase. This space seamlessly transitions into a BRAND-NEW GOURMET KITCHEN...making a delight for all of your culinary adventures. It is complete with Energy Star Stainless Steel Appliances, Sleek Quartz Counter Tops, Soft Close Cabinetry and an Enormous Island with BREAKFAST BAR. There is also room for a cozy, duo dining table as well. The living room beckons with its high ceilings, wood burning fireplace, and a decorative bay window that allows for plenty of natural light and a seasonal river view. As you explore this home's nooks and crannies, you will discover a dining room area that walks out to the back yard, a pantry, and a new half bath on the main floor, too!
Ascend up the stairs to the second floor to find three roomy bedrooms with ample closet space, a luxurious full bathroom with a whirlpool tub and the convenience of having a designated laundry room on this level. A huge walk-up attic, if finished, could add another level of inviting living space. Stepping outside, the landscape is complete with vibrant flower beds, a comfy fire pit area, and a spacious patio area that offers the perfect spot for dining al fresco & entertaining. Just a stroll from the quaint stores and restaurants in the popular Rondout Historic Waterfront District, the Kingston Point Beach, the Empire Rail Trail & the trendy new bar Sorry Charlie. Easy access to the NYS Thruway and less than a 2-hour drive from NYC.
